Understanding Your Website’s Needs: Traffic Analysis and Scalability

Before diving into specific hosting solutions, you need a clear understanding of your website’s current and projected traffic. Analyze your website analytics (Google Analytics is a great resource) to identify peak traffic times, average daily visitors, and the types of content driving the most traffic. This data will inform your choice of hosting plan and features. Consider future growth – how much traffic do you anticipate in the next 6 months, 1 year, and 5 years? Choosing a scalable high-traffic website hosting solution is critical for accommodating this growth without performance hiccups.

Choosing the Right Hosting Type: Shared vs. VPS vs. Dedicated Servers

The type of hosting you choose drastically impacts performance, especially with high traffic.

  • Shared Hosting: This is the most budget-friendly option, but it’s rarely suitable for high-traffic websites. Multiple websites share the same server resources, so performance can suffer when one site experiences a traffic surge. Avoid shared hosting for high-traffic sites unless your traffic is exceptionally low and consistent.

  • VPS (Virtual Private Server) Hosting: VPS hosting offers a more robust solution. You get a dedicated portion of a server’s resources, providing better performance and control than shared hosting. This is a popular choice for mid-level traffic websites experiencing growth. VPS plans offer scalability, allowing you to upgrade resources as needed.

  • Dedicated Server Hosting: This is the most powerful and expensive option, offering complete control over the server. Dedicated servers are ideal for high-traffic websites requiring maximum performance and reliability. They provide the most resources and customization options, eliminating resource contention issues.

  • Cloud Hosting: Cloud hosting uses a network of servers to distribute your website’s traffic and resources. This provides excellent scalability and reliability, as resources are dynamically allocated based on demand. This is a very popular option for high-traffic websites, as it offers significant flexibility and resilience. Major providers include Amazon Web Services (AWS), Google Cloud Platform (GCP), and Microsoft Azure.

  • High CPU and RAM: More powerful hardware translates to faster processing and better handling of concurrent users. Ensure your chosen hosting plan offers sufficient CPU and RAM to accommodate your traffic.

  • Fast SSD Storage: Solid State Drives (SSDs) offer significantly faster read/write speeds compared to traditional HDDs, leading to faster website loading times. Look for hosting providers that utilize SSD storage exclusively.

  • Content Delivery Network (CDN): A CDN distributes your website’s content across multiple servers globally, reducing latency and improving loading speeds for users in different geographic locations. CDNs are essential for high-traffic websites with a global audience. Learn more about CDNs

  • Scalability and Upgradability: Your hosting plan should allow for easy scaling of resources (CPU, RAM, bandwidth) as your website grows. Avoid plans with inflexible resource allocation.

  • 99.9% Uptime Guarantee: Downtime can be devastating for a high-traffic website. Choose a provider with a strong uptime guarantee and a proven track record of reliability.

Database Optimization for High-Traffic Websites: MySQL vs. PostgreSQL

The database is the heart of your website’s data management. For high-traffic websites, database optimization is crucial for performance. Common choices include MySQL and PostgreSQL.

  • MySQL: A widely used open-source relational database management system (RDBMS), known for its speed and scalability. It’s a good choice for many high-traffic sites.

  • PostgreSQL: Another powerful open-source RDBMS, known for its robust features and advanced capabilities. It’s a strong contender if you need more advanced database functionalities.

Your choice depends on your specific needs and the complexity of your website’s database interactions. Consider working with a database administrator to optimize your database queries and schema for optimal performance.

Security Considerations for High-Traffic Websites: Protecting Your Data

High-traffic websites are prime targets for cyberattacks. Robust security measures are paramount. Look for hosting providers that offer:

  • Regular Security Audits and Backups: Regular security checks and automated backups are essential to mitigate risks and ensure data recovery in case of an attack or system failure.

  • Firewall Protection: A firewall acts as a barrier against unauthorized access to your server. Ensure your hosting provider offers robust firewall protection.

  • SSL Certificates: SSL certificates encrypt data transmitted between your website and users, protecting sensitive information. This is essential for maintaining user trust and complying with security standards.

  • Regular Software Updates: Keeping your server software and applications up-to-date is crucial for patching security vulnerabilities. Choose a provider that proactively handles software updates.

Website Caching Strategies: Improving Performance and Reducing Server Load

Caching is a crucial technique to improve website performance, especially under heavy traffic. Caching stores frequently accessed data closer to the user, reducing server load and improving loading times.

  • Browser Caching: Enables web browsers to store website assets locally, minimizing requests to the server on subsequent visits.

  • Server-Side Caching: Stores frequently accessed pages or data on the server, reducing the time it takes to generate them. Popular solutions include Memcached and Redis.

  • CDN Caching: CDNs store website content across multiple servers globally, enabling faster delivery to users in different locations.

Monitoring and Optimization: Keeping Your Website Running Smoothly

Continuous monitoring is vital for maintaining optimal performance. Utilize website monitoring tools to track key metrics like server load, response times, and error rates. Identify bottlenecks and proactively address them. Regularly analyze your website’s performance data to pinpoint areas for optimization, ensuring your high-traffic website hosting solution continues to meet your needs.
